Her parents, Füsun Sayek, a respected physician, and İskender Sayek, a distinguished medical professor, instilled in her a passion for learning and a commitment to making a positive impact on society. Selin’s diverse heritage, with roots in Niğde and Arsuz, Hatay, enriched her understanding of different cultures and perspectives from an early age.

After completing her primary education at Çankaya Primary School, Selin excelled in her studies at TED Ankara College and graduated in 1993 from the prestigious Middle East Technical University with a degree in Economics. Her academic curiosity led her to pursue advanced studies in the United States, where she earned both her master’s and doctoral degrees in Economics from Duke University by 1999.

An Accomplished Economist with a Vision

Armed with a strong academic foundation and a deep understanding of economic principles, Selin Sayek Böke returned to Turkey and embarked on a remarkable journey as an economist and academician. She joined the faculty at Bilkent University in 2003, where she passionately shared her knowledge and expertise with eager young minds. Over the years, she became a prominent figure in the field of economics, known for her critical insights and innovative ideas.

Selin Sayek Böke’s commitment to driving positive change extended beyond academia. Her desire to contribute to the betterment of society and shape economic policies to benefit the masses led her to venture into the realm of politics. In 2014, she was elected to the Party Council of the Republican People’s Party (CHP), one of Turkey’s major political parties.

Her dedication and determination caught the attention of voters, and in the June 2015 Turkish general elections, she secured a seat in the Grand National Assembly of Turkey, representing the vibrant city of Izmir. Her contributions to economic policies and her articulate stance on various social issues soon earned her widespread recognition and respect within the party and beyond.

Championing Social Progress and International Recognition

As a forward-thinking politician and an advocate for social justice, Selin Sayek Böke became a leading voice in the CHP, serving as the Deputy Chair responsible for Economic Policies and as the Party Spokesperson. Her focus on promoting social welfare and sustainable development resonated with many, and she gained admiration both nationally and internationally.

In 2019, she achieved a historic milestone by becoming the Vice-President of the Group of Socialists, Democrats, and Greens in the Parliamentary Assembly of the Council of Europe. Her appointment marked the first time a Turkish parliamentarian held such a significant position in the European political arena.
